With about 90% of its nearly 12 million citizens relying on subsistence agriculture (and the overwhelming majority of them living in extreme poverty) food scarcity is a major concern: the level of food insecurity is almost twice as high as the average for sub-Saharan African countries. Rich in gold, oil, uranium and diamonds, the Central African Republic is a very wealthy country inhabited by very poor people. With 80 million hectares of arable land, over a thousand minerals and valuable metals under its surface and a citizen median age of just 17, the Democratic Republic of the Congothe World Bank sayshas the potential to become one of the richest African nations and a driver of growth for the entire continent (even just by virtue of being the worlds largest producer of cobalt and Africas leading source of copper, two metals essential in the production of electric vehicles). In the meantime, more than sixty years after winning its independence from France and two decades after becoming an oil-producing nation, Chad still ranks near the bottom of the United Nations Human Development Index. However, in most cases, youd find both crime and political instability in the same place. The Islamic State also gained a foothold in the country post-withdrawal of the US forces. The. In the meantime, outside the oil sector, the majority of the population is employed in traditional agriculture, although violencealong with alternating droughts and floods often prevents farmers from planting or harvesting crops.
